| Product Name | 1,2,3-Propanetricarboxylic acid, 2-hydroxy-, trihydrazide |
| CAS No. | 18960-42-4 |
| Molecular Formula | C6H14N6O4 |
18960-42-4 1,2,3-propanetricarboxylic acid, 2-hydroxy-, trihydrazide
service@apichina.com